Traditional mining operations often rely on power-hungry ASICs (Application-Specific Integrated Circuits) that guzzle electricity like a thirsty traveler in the desert. This not only strains power grids but also leads to hefty electricity bills, eating into potential profits. Eco-friendly hardware, on the other hand, focuses on energy efficiency, minimizing the environmental footprint while maximizing mining output. This could involve using newer generation chips with improved power efficiency or optimizing cooling systems to reduce energy waste. The promise is clear: mine more, consume less.

Beyond the hardware itself, the location of your mining operation plays a critical role. Think about it: a mining farm in a region powered by coal-fired plants contributes significantly to carbon emissions. In contrast, a mining facility powered by renewable energy sources, such as solar, wind, or hydroelectric power, drastically reduces its environmental impact. This is the essence of sustainable Bitcoin mining – leveraging clean energy to secure the blockchain and contribute to a greener future.

Beyond Bitcoin, the energy-efficient ethos extends to mining other cryptocurrencies like Dogecoin. While often perceived as a meme coin, Dogecoin mining, particularly when merged with Litecoin mining, benefits from optimized hardware and energy-conscious practices. This combined mining, also known as merged mining, allows for the simultaneous mining of both cryptocurrencies, increasing efficiency and reducing energy consumption compared to independent mining operations.

Ethereum, with its transition to a Proof-of-Stake (PoS) consensus mechanism, represents a shift away from energy-intensive Proof-of-Work (PoW) mining. However, mining still plays a role in other PoW cryptocurrencies, making energy efficiency paramount. The lessons learned from optimizing Bitcoin mining can be applied to other PoW chains, ensuring that the entire cryptocurrency ecosystem moves towards greater sustainability.
